CXml for External Catalog - PunchOut

Hi experts,
 
I am trying to configure CXml for the site 'Staples.com'.
 
Given below the steps I tried for registration
1) Created an account with my organization id in Staples.com. I opted as Business stating my organization name. 
2) An email arrived to validate my id. 
 
What are the next steps? How do I get the details of credentials, ID Domain, secret, URL?

    Hi,
    You can refer to this official documentation: Set up an external catalog for PunchOut e-procurement - Supply Chain Management | Dynamics 365 | Microsoft LearnIt was said in the article: To set up the communication, your vendor has to provide pieces of information for you to use in the configuration of the external catalog such as Identity, domain of the buyers company, for example, "DUNS" and "DUNS number", credentials, and the URL to reach the vendors catalog. Below you can find a description of the tags that are included in the template:

    All the information you need to configure the External catalog is always provided by the vendor (or, a 3rd party which the vendor is using for PunchOut).
     
    Normally, your procurement team have an account manager at the vendor who can hook you up with someone who can provide these technical details. Normally this person would also help with testing prior to adding the PunchOut catalog to your live environment and making it available to users.
     
    If you are trying to enable PunchOut for personal testing, this is tricky. I don't know of anywhere that offers a free PunchOut connection for testing purposes. If you have an Amazon Business account, that could be one route to try.
